CLND - net assets per share is @15.
REEF W19 - expires on June 2015. REEF needs to perform above 45 to be successful
CITK - No plan to start constructing the hotel. Land value is reducesing ( leased land for 99 years) and it has invested 1.2Bn ruppees on CLND at expensive price.

But CLND net assets per share is 15. Can't justify share value above 25 with EPS , NAV, PE, PBV. highly overvalued @current price.
CITK can't start any hotel projects.They can give thousand reasons, but there is only one reason. They don't have any cash to build a hotel. Most of the money is stucked in CLND.
They have 2.1bn assets. 400Mn land.
They have bought shares more than 1.2bn. DJ first bough CLND at 20. Then after 2 weeks he sold his stake @43 to the CITK. So investment in the CLND has huge loss.
Also CITK has loss 330,239,887 before start doing anything.
Normally we can expect a interest income when we have lot of money. But they have spend 330Mn for nothing I guess.
The last option to raise the price is give some right issue with warrants. At least some share holders can exit with little sorrow.

We can't trade with REEF group with fundamental mindset. Non of their share backed by fundamentals other than NAVPS. But we should look at future potential. CITW will start to show operative income from this quarter onwards and Government expecting a boom in Tourism  on next few years and spend billions of dollars to build infrastructure.

So eventually we can expect a growth in Hotel sector.

Mate for REEF warrants june 2015 is a long way ahead. We will able to see lot of ups and downs until that time. Who knows where REEF.N will positioned at that time. Very Happy If someone play it right you can make tons of profits but otherwise you can be bankrupt too.. Wink

It is more important to look at technicals, trends and read the mind of manipulators rather than fundamentals when trading with these type of trading stocks. Very Happy
